不能直接使用CentOS的官方源。虽然欧拉操作系统(EulerOS)和CentOS都是基于Linux内核的操作系统,并且它们都属于Red Hat Enterprise Linux (RHEL) 的衍生版本,但这并不意味着它们之间可以完全互换使用软件包或仓库源。下面将从几个方面详细解释这一结论。
首先,我们需要了解欧拉操作系统的背景。欧拉操作系统是由华为开发的一款企业级Linux操作系统,旨在提供稳定、安全、高效的服务平台,适用于云计算、大数据、AI等应用场景。它不仅继承了RHEL的技术优势,还融入了华为在服务器领域的技术积累和实践经验。因此,欧拉操作系统在系统架构、内核优化、安全机制等方面有着自己的独特设计和实现。
其次,CentOS是一个社区支持的企业级计算平台,它的目标是提供一个与RHEL功能相同但免费使用的操作系统。虽然CentOS尽可能地保持与RHEL的一致性,但在某些细节上仍可能存在差异,比如软件包的版本、补丁的更新周期等。这些差异可能会影响到软件的兼容性和稳定性。
再次,软件包的兼容性问题。即使欧拉操作系统和CentOS都是基于RHEL,但由于它们各自的维护团队、更新策略和技术路线不同,导致两个系统中提供的软件包可能会有版本差异。如果强行使用CentOS的官方源,可能会遇到依赖关系不匹配、库文件冲突等问题,影响系统的正常运行。
最后,考虑到安全性。使用非官方或未经验证的软件源,可能会引入未知的安全风险。官方提供的软件源经过严格测试和审核,能够确保软件包的质量和安全性。而第三方源或非官方源则难以保证这一点。对于企业和个人用户来说,选择一个可靠、稳定的软件源是非常重要的。
综上所述,尽管欧拉操作系统和CentOS有一定的相似性,但出于兼容性、稳定性和安全性的考虑,建议不要直接使用CentOS的官方源。如果需要安装特定的软件包,可以通过查找欧拉操作系统社区提供的资源或者手动编译安装来解决。同时,由于开源社区的发展,好多的软件项目开始支持多种Linux发行版,用户也可以关注相关项目的官方网站获取最新信息和支持。
CLOUD云